Can I claim compensation for personal injuries after being attacked by my neighbours cat through no fault of my own?
I was attacked in my front garden and suffered bites and scratches which led to a nasty infection, how much could I be entitled to?
Do I need to press charges against the owner or have the cat put down to claim compensation?
 
Thank you for your enquiry.

I am pleased to advise that, in theory, based on the accident circumstances, you would be entitled to make a claim against the cats owner.

In relation to your question regarding how much compensation you will receive, this is entirely dependent upon medical evidence. Medical evidence is obtained to both prove causation (the injuries where sustained as a direct result of the incident that has occurred) and provide a basis upon which we as your legal representative can accurately place a valuation upon your claim.

If the injury has left scarring, you could receive around £4,000 upwards.
